Description

Pinoxaden is a selective post-emergence herbicide belonging to the phenylpyrazole class, primarily used for controlling annual grass weeds in cereal crops. It functions by inhibiting the enzyme acetyl-CoA carboxylase (ACCase), which is essential for fatty acid synthesis in grasses, leading to effective weed control.
